QsTenG Performance
Ethernet continues to be the dominant network technology, the result of wide adoption of low cost components and a high degree of inter-operability. Ethernet has grown both in functionality and performance, adopting technologies that were previously the domain of specialist proprietary networks. The growth in bandwidth hungry applications and the demand for fully interoperable Gb/s data centre infrastructure provides a growing market for companies developing the next generation commodity Ethernet devices. Quadrics is a leading interconnect provider, specialising in products for the High Performance Computing (HPC) market1 and offers its second Ethernet product, designed for smaller networks. Quadrics is offering the 24 10 Gb/s port QsTenG TG-201 1U, a one rack-unit solution based on the Fulcrum FM2224 switch, available in CX-4 copper and XFP optics versions. TG-201 performance was evaluated using Mryricom 10 Gb/s Ethernet adapters. The results presented here show that the switch sustains link layer bandwidth and that low latencies are achieved. The combination of Quadrics switches and Myricom adapters provides a cost effective solution for bandwidth hungry compute cluster and data centre applications and brings a very lower latency.
